FATEs in certain Dawntrail zones have unironically been kinda good. In two Dawntrail zones, Shaaloani, and Living Memory, there is a possibility to spawn a world boss FATE which is balanced to be like an alliance raid in the overworld. These specific FATEs reward, tokens that can be traded in for goodies like capybara mount, and the cursed Squirrel suit, 100 bicolor gems, and a ton of experience. When 7.0 launched, they made made a change to another FATE system, the Forlorn Maiden. The Forlorn Maiden or The Forlorn are additional enemies that have a chance to spawn in almost any FATE in zones Stormblood and above as the fate is being completed. When a Forlorn Maiden is defeated, the players who participated the FATE get a buff called Twist of Fate which buffs the experience, and now with Dawntrail, the amount of bicolor gems you get from the next fate is also boosted. The Forlorn Maiden gives a 50% boost to FATE rewards, and The Forlorn gives a 4x boost.
So what has been happening is that when a world boss FATE spawns in like in Shaaloani or Living Memory, there will be groups of players who will go out and complete the smaller FATEs in the zone in hopes of spawning a Forlorn Maiden instead of just waiting around for the world boss to be pulled. When a Forlorn Maiden is found, the players will try hold off on completing the FATE, and the location of the Maiden FATE is relayed in shout chat so that other players can get credit, and get the Twist of Fate buff so they can use the buff on the world boss, and get a significant boost in experience, and gems. This bit of emergent gameplay also applies to older zones that have world boss FATEs for a total of six zones across three expansions.
It's just a neat little moment of comradery. This loop reminds me of the Elementals that can spawn in Eureka zones. And yes, Eureka, Bozja, and Shade's are just FATE boxes, but that's not bad. So if they keep making adjustments to FATEs that encourage cooperation between players, and not just mindlessly zerg down FATEs alone, they could turn every zone into like a Eureka-like experience.

There is a whole community around hunts and it's content I spend lots of time doing (with breaks). Lots of people fight them, on a regular basis, leaving bodies everywhere. They have lots of fun mechanics and I enjoy them a lot.
The distinction between B, A and S ranks is because they work very differently. B ranks, casual players go out and fight them each week in the open world. A ranks are fought pretty regularly, usually by hunt trains, every 6 hours or so. S ranks have spawn conditions people go out and attempt regularly and are a whole social rabbit hole in this game with long-term achievements tied to them. Since they all work very differently, they deserve separate bullet points.
And while there is FATE farming as a regular activity that is done for gemstone farming, the achievement FATEs are a bit of a separate attraction and really not quite as much of a pushover in many cases because they bring lots of people together to fight them, as such they again deserve separate bullet points in my opinion.
And Treasure Hunts are separate to hunts, so also deserve their own bullet point.
